Equity and Inclusion - Implicit Bias in The Workplace

 

February 17, 2022

10:00 - 11:00 a.m EST

Presenter: Dr. Roger Cleveland, Director, Faculty Diversity & Development, Eastern Kentucky University

In this workshop participants will explore the concept of implicit bias and examine the dynamics inherent when different cultural backgrounds interact. Dr. Cleveland will lead participants in examining their own implicit biases and how our biases and perceptions can impact professional relationships, organizational climate, and productivity in the workplace. He will also provide strategies for disrupting or reducing implicit bias.
